The Meeting Point and Logistics
The tour begins at a designated meeting point where the vans and guides, identified by the “SPLASH Azores Adventure” logo, await you. Transportation is straightforward, and the guides help to distribute the certified canyoning gear — including helmets, neoprene suits, socks, and canyoning boots. The gear is a critical part of the experience, keeping you warm in the chilly waters and protected during jumps and slides.
The activity lasts around 3 hours, but expect some time for gear fitting, safety instructions, and a scenic walk through the park to reach the starting point. The last part of the tour is a return to the starting location, with the activity ending where it began, making logistics simple and stress-free.
The Route and Highlights
The descent takes you through a stream dotted with six waterfalls, offering a variety of challenges suited to different comfort levels. The activity involves rapelling techniques, which are explained clearly beforehand, along with other fun elements like slides, toboggans, and jumps. No two minutes are the same, and the varied terrain keeps the adrenaline flowing while offering plenty of opportunities for awe-inspiring photos.

What’s Included and What to Bring
All equipment — including certified guides, ropes, neoprene suits, helmets, and harnesses — is provided, simplifying the planning process. You’ll also receive a safety briefing and a technical briefing to prepare you for each activity.
What should you bring? A towel, snacks, sunscreen, water, and beachwear are recommended. Avoid sandals or flip-flops, as they’re not allowed, along with weapons, sharp objects, alcohol, and drugs. Wearing proper clothing and footwear will ensure you stay comfortable and safe throughout.

FAQ
Is this tour suitable for children?
Yes, it is suitable for children over 7 years old, as long as they meet the activity’s physical requirements. Always check with the guides beforehand.
How long does the activity last?
The canyoning experience lasts approximately 3 hours, including gear fitting, safety briefings, and the descent.
What should I wear?
Bring beachwear or quick-drying clothes, a towel, and snacks. Wear suitable footwear like canyoning boots — sandals or flip-flops are not allowed.
Will I be safe?
Absolutely. The guides prioritize safety, providing thorough briefings, high-quality gear, and close supervision throughout the activity.
What is included in the price?
All necessary canyoning equipment, safety and technical briefings, and professional guides are included in the $74 price.
Can I cancel if my plans change?
Yes, you can cancel up to 24 hours in advance for a full refund, offering flexibility for your travel plans.
Is it physically demanding?
The activity involves some walking, jumping, and rappelling, so some level of fitness is recommended. It’s suitable for active individuals but not for those with certain health issues.
What language do guides speak?
Guides speak English, Portuguese, and Spanish, accommodating a diverse range of travelers.
What if I want photos of my adventure?
Guides often take photos or videos, and some reviews mention included GoPro footage. Check if this is part of your package or available as an add-on.
